Browse Source

招聘职位

Xiao_123 6 months ago
parent
commit
4f12da1d94

+ 8 - 2
src/views/menduner/system/enterprise/message/details/components/job.vue

@@ -6,7 +6,7 @@
     <el-table-column label="薪资" align="center" prop="payFrom">
     <el-table-column label="薪资" align="center" prop="payFrom">
       <template #default="scope">
       <template #default="scope">
         <span v-if="scope.row.payFrom && scope.row.payTo">
         <span v-if="scope.row.payFrom && scope.row.payTo">
-          {{ scope.row.payFrom }} - {{ scope.row.payTo }}/{{ payUnit.find(e => e.value === Number(scope.row.payUnit)).label }}
+          {{ scope.row.payFrom }} - {{ scope.row.payTo }}/{{ payUnit.find(e => e.value === Number(scope.row.payUnit))?.label }}
         </span>
         </span>
         <span v-else>面议</span>
         <span v-else>面议</span>
       </template>
       </template>
@@ -61,7 +61,7 @@
       <el-descriptions-item label="详细地址">{{ itemData.address }}</el-descriptions-item>
       <el-descriptions-item label="详细地址">{{ itemData.address }}</el-descriptions-item>
       <el-descriptions-item label="薪资">
       <el-descriptions-item label="薪资">
         <span v-if="itemData.payFrom && itemData.payTo">
         <span v-if="itemData.payFrom && itemData.payTo">
-          {{ itemData.payFrom }} - {{ itemData.payTo }}/{{ payUnit.find(e => e.value === Number(itemData.payUnit)).label }}
+          {{ itemData.payFrom }} - {{ itemData.payTo }}/{{ payUnit.find(e => e.value === Number(itemData.payUnit))?.label }}
         </span>
         </span>
         <span v-else>面议</span>
         <span v-else>面议</span>
       </el-descriptions-item>
       </el-descriptions-item>
@@ -165,3 +165,9 @@ const openDetail = (item) => {
   dialogVisible.value = true
   dialogVisible.value = true
 }
 }
 </script>
 </script>
+
+<style scoped lang="scss">
+:deep(.el-descriptions__label.el-descriptions__cell.is-bordered-label) {
+  width: 100px;
+}
+</style>